Daniel Hinchman Obituary


DANIEL LEE HINCHMAN, 64, of Barboursville, WV, went home to his Lord and Savior Saturday, November 8, 2025.
Graveside services will be at Swann Cemetery at 11 a.m. Wednesday, November 12, 2025, by Pastor Rob Paddock. Danny was born May 10, 1961, oldest son of the late Robert (Bob) and Mollie Hinchman.
He graduated from Barboursville High School in 1979, from there he served 4 years in the Army where he was medically discharged. He worked at Camden Park for many years which he loved very much.
He is survived by two younger brothers Joseph Alan Hinchman and wife Kim of Barboursville, and Michael Brian Hinchman and wife Donna of Barboursville. He is also survived by three nephews and two nieces, Trent Hinchman and wife Brandi of Martinsburg, WV, Bethany Warner and husband Brandon of Barboursville, Bryan Andrew Hinchman and wife Amelia of Chesapeake, Ohio, Brian Harris and fiancé Faith of Proctorville, Ohio, and Victoria Harris of Barboursville. He is also survived by five great nieces and nephews Mylah, Bennett, Grant, Ridge and Lilith.
We would like to thank everyone in the ICU at St. Mary's for taking good care of Danny and all of us who were there by his side, and we would like to thank the V.A. for their time and care with Danny. A very very special thank you goes to his case worker Heather Rice for the V.A. She was a blessing to Danny.
In lieu of flowers memorial contributions may be made to Gideon's International, Cabell-Lincoln Gideon's P.O. Box 21, Ona, WV, 25545.
Wallace Funeral Home, Barboursville, is assisting the family with arrangements.
